Job Description

Doodle Labs is the global leader in high-performance private wireless systems. We build cutting-edge mesh networks for robotics, drones, and the Industrial Internet of Things. Doodle Labs has experienced rapid growth over the past five years as our radio systems have been adopted by Fortune 500 companies (e.g. Airbus, General Electric) and industry-leading innovators (e.g. Boston Dynamics, FLIR).

We are looking for a Sales Engineer to be part of our direct sales team that sells next-gen wireless networking solutions to our customers. You will facilitate a technical sales process and engage with our Application Engineering and Support teams. This is a remote position and travel will be required (around 20%) to meet with customers and attend industry tradeshows.



 

What you will be doing:

  • Work with our inside sales team and application engineers to qualify, create, and close sales opportunities
  • Lead the sales process with high importance customers, which includes articulating the capabilities of Doodle Labs’ technology, system planning, integration support, and system optimization
  • Project manage technical support issues with customers that have been handed off to our team of Application Engineers
  • Establish and grow relationships with engineers, purchasing/contract administrators, and right-level leaders to proactively grow the business at your assigned customer organizations
  • Maintain a real-time sales opportunity pipeline for forecasting purposes in our CRM (HubSpot), and document customer activities
  • Proactively engage with new potential accounts in your assigned industry/geography to generate new sales opportunities
  • Articulate your previous week’s activities, the coming week’s plans, and review your updated sales pipeline during weekly 1:1s with our Senior Director of Sales

What we need to see:
  • 5+ years of proven success as an outside or inside salesperson selling technical products to the engineering organizations of accounts
  • Must be a U.S. Citizen to engage with US Government customers
  • Bachelor’s degree in engineering or business or equivalent experience

Ways to stand out from the crowd:
  • History of successfully selling embedded products into OEM applications
  • Excellent interpersonal skills and ability to use simple communication that conveys sophisticated concepts
  • Experience working with VARs and/or System Integrators to accelerate solution deployment
  • Demonstrated ability to proactively expand business into new accounts
  • Knowledge of wireless communication systems, RF signal propagation, and digital communication technologies

Doodle Labs is a very fast-growing company with an extremely bright future.  If you are  committed to success and excellence   in all that you do then we would love to have you as part of our amazing sales team.

The compensation range is $125,000 - $175,000, including variable compensation such as Performance Bonus and Company Profit Sharing. Your cash compensation will be determined based on your location, experience, and the pay of employees in similar positions. You will also be eligible for benefits.
